Commissioner Trevanion, Plymouth Yard. Receipt of letter with a copy of an anonymous letter complaining about some of the Officers in Ordinary neglecting their duties, which will be investigated and reported on and another to the Officers about procuring Shipwrights, Caulkers and Bricklayers for Jamaica and the terms offered. Has paid the Exeter and York's companies and is sending a warrant appointing David Harden, Boatswain of the Severn.
